WebFinancial Support for People living with Parkinson’s in Georgia. The APDA Arizona Chapter is pleased to offer a Financial Support Program which provides financial assistance to people with Parkinson’s disease (PD) and their families who reside in the state of Arizona. Approved applicants will be eligible for up to $300 once per calendar ...
